Полное руководство по созданию базы данных SQL Server: методы и примеры кода

Создание базы данных SQL Server — фундаментальная задача управления базами данных. В этой статье блога мы рассмотрим различные методы создания базы данных SQL Server, а также примеры кода. Независимо от того, являетесь ли вы новичком или опытным разработчиком, это подробное руководство предоставит вам знания для эффективного создания баз данных.

Метод 1: использование SQL Server Management Studio (SSMS)
SQL Server Management Studio (SSMS) — популярный графический инструмент, предоставляемый Microsoft для управления базами данных SQL Server. Чтобы создать базу данных с помощью SSMS, выполните следующие действия:

  1. Откройте SSMS и подключитесь к экземпляру SQL Server.
  2. Нажмите правой кнопкой мыши узел «Базы данных» в обозревателе объектов и выберите «Новая база данных».
  3. Введите имя базы данных и настройте нужные параметры (например, расположение файлов, параметры сортировки).
  4. Нажмите «ОК», чтобы создать базу данных.

Метод 2: использование сценариев T-SQL
Transact-SQL (T-SQL) — мощный язык, используемый для взаимодействия с SQL Server. Вы можете создать базу данных с помощью сценариев T-SQL со следующим кодом:

CREATE DATABASE YourDatabaseName;

Замените «YourDatabaseName» на желаемое имя вашей базы данных. Выполните сценарий в SSMS или любом редакторе T-SQL, подключенном к вашему экземпляру SQL Server.

Метод 3: использование утилиты SQLCMD
SQLCMD — это инструмент командной строки, предоставляемый Microsoft для выполнения команд и сценариев T-SQL. Чтобы создать базу данных с помощью SQLCMD, откройте командную строку и выполните следующую команду:

sqlcmd -S ServerName -d master -Q "CREATE DATABASE YourDatabaseName;"

Замените «ServerName» именем вашего экземпляра SQL Server, а «YourDatabaseName» — желаемым именем вашей базы данных.

Метод 4. Использование PowerShell
PowerShell — это язык сценариев, который можно использовать для автоматизации административных задач в SQL Server. Вы можете создать базу данных с помощью PowerShell с помощью следующего кода:

$serverInstance = "ServerName"
$databaseName = "YourDatabaseName"
$server = New-Object Microsoft.SqlServer.Management.Smo.Server($serverInstance)
$database = New-Object Microsoft.SqlServer.Management.Smo.Database($server, $databaseName)
$database.Create()

Замените «ServerName» именем вашего экземпляра SQL Server, а «YourDatabaseName» — желаемым именем вашей базы данных.

Создать базу данных SQL Server можно различными способами, включая SQL Server Management Studio, сценарии T-SQL, утилиту SQLCMD и PowerShell. Каждый метод обеспечивает гибкость и подходит для различных сценариев. Используя эти методы, вы можете эффективно создавать базы данных, отвечающие требованиям вашего приложения.

Не забудьте выбрать метод, который соответствует предпочитаемому вами рабочему процессу и среде разработки. Удачного создания базы данных!